Recruiter - Construction

Path Construction is seeking a qualified Construction Recruiter to join our organization in Arlington Heights, IL. We are a rapidly growing commercial general contractor with offices in Arlington Heights, IL; Charlotte, NC; Knoxville, TN; Tampa, FL; Dallas, TX; and Phoenix, AZ, with projects ongoing throughout the United States.

Founded in 2008, Path Construction provides a vast array of construction services to multiple regions throughout the country. Our expertise is diverse and includes experience on small and large projects of many different types, including but not limited to: healthcare, multi-family, senior living, education, hospitality, self-storage, retail, transportation, water and waste treatment, convention centers, laboratories, and correctional. The main philosophy and strategy for the growth of our organization is to be on the cutting edge of all aspects of the construction process. Additionally, our unmatched customer satisfaction and, most importantly, the development and quality of our people drive our success. For more about us, please visit our website at www.pathcc.com.

Duties for a Construction Recruiter include:

  • Recruit utilizing multiple platforms (Linkedin, Indeed, etc.)
  • Evaluate online applications
  • Post new positions
  • Manage the flow of candidates
  • Phone screen applicants
  • Schedule interviews
  • Interview applicants
  • Conduct reference checks
  • Manage a data base of applicants
  • Constant follow ups with applicants/prospects
  • Draft offer letters
  • Attend weekly meetings with Vice President, CFO, and Divisions Managers on staffing needs
  • Plan, organize and attend recruiting events such as college career fairs
  • Plan and organize college guest lecture presentations
  • Provide new ideas to enhance recruiting and onboarding
  • Provide new ideas to enhance culture
  • Assist in new hire orientation
  • Construction recruiting experience or Construction knowledge
  • Strong verbal and written skills
  • Confident and approachable
  • Provides constant follow ups
  • Organized
  • Self-starter and problem solver
  • Ability to switch from task to task
  • Experience using recruiting platforms (Linkedin, Applicant Tracking System, Indeed, etc)
  • Salary Range: $50,000 to $85,000
  • Vacation and Sick Days
  • Annual Bonus Program
  • 401(k)
  • Health, Dental, Vision, Life, Long Term & Short Term Disability
  • Company cellphone and computer

Common Interview Questions for Recruiter - Construction
Can you describe your experience with construction recruiting?

When answering this question, focus on specific experiences you've had in construction recruiting. Highlight the types of roles you've filled, recruitment strategies you've used, and any measurable results you achieved, such as reducing the time to hire or increasing candidate satisfaction.

How do you evaluate candidates during the interview process?

Discuss your approach to evaluating candidates, including the criteria you consider important for construction roles. Mention how you assess both technical skills and cultural fit, and provide examples of questions you find effective in understanding a candidate's qualifications.

What strategies do you use to attract top talent in the construction industry?

Share specific strategies that have worked for you, such as leveraging social media platforms, attending industry events, or forming partnerships with educational institutions. Discuss how you build a strong employer brand to attract top candidates.

How do you manage your applicant database?

Talk about your experience with Applicant Tracking Systems and how you ensure your database is organized and up-to-date. Mention strategies for categorizing candidates based on skills and availability, allowing for quick access when staffing needs arise.

Why is follow-up important in the recruiting process?

Emphasize the significance of communication in the recruiting process. Explain how timely follow-ups can enhance candidate experience, keep them engaged, and contribute to a positive employer brand. Provide examples of how you've successfully maintained communication with candidates.
